LOADING...
LOADING...
LOADING...
当前位置:主页 > 知识列表 >

比特币hash算法

1. BTC的挖矿算法究竟是如何运算的?

比特币使用的SHA-256Hash算法SHA-256的Hash算法采用512位(即64个字节)的输入块。下图显示了比特币区块链中的一个区块以及它的Hash值。Hash 函数是一个叫做SHA-256的函数。编者按:本文来自加密谷Live(ID:cryptovalley),作者:SajjadHussain,翻译:李翰博,Odaily星球日报经授权转载。比特币挖矿是比特币系统...

知识:挖矿,比特币

2. 区块链核心技术演进之路-算法演进

...里被讨论,大概没几个人知道论文的意义。时间的年轮很快转入新的一年,比特币第一版本代码发布,1月4日,创世块被挖出来,5天之后,第二个块产生,比特币网络正式启动,一个自称中本聪的人悄悄在互联网应用这片汪洋大海吹起一片涟漪,时至今日,这片涟漪已形成滔滔大浪。   当年能读...

知识:区块链核心技术,数字货币算法

3. 加密货币如何加密

...数是一个无比神奇的东西,说他替中本聪打下了半壁江山一点不为过,学习比特币应该从学习Hash函数入手,理解了Hash函数再去学比特币原理将事半功倍,不然将处处感觉混沌,难以开窍。而中本聪也将Hash函数的所有特性使用得淋漓尽致:已经有很多Hash函数被设计出来并广泛应用,不过Hash函数一般安...

知识:区块链,比特币,挖矿

4. 零极ZOL:揭秘区块链的核心技术之「哈希与加密算法 」

...20世纪公共密钥被发明之前的这几千年时间里,密码学的原理都是一样的。比特币和区块链的加密方式,跟凯撒密码的原理区别,也就是多了公钥而已。密码学是研究如何隐密地传递信息的学科。在现代特别指对信息及其传输的数学性研究,常被认为是数学和计算机科学的分支,和信息论也密切相关。...

知识:比特币,算法,区块,密码学

5. 什么是哈希算法如何计算?

...多的一种算法,它被广泛的使用在构建区块和确认交易的完整性上。例如在比特币中,使用哈希算法把交易生成数据摘要,当前区块里面包含上一个区块的哈希值,后面一个区块又包含当前区块的哈希值,就这样一个接一个的连接起来,形成一个不可逆向篡改的链表。哈希算法的特征除了快速对比内容...

知识:区块,区块链,算法,区块链的

6. 哈希函数的过去、现在与未来

...个关键词,而且似乎对安全性来说特别关键。(实际上也确实是。)对于像比特币和以太坊这样由成千上万的节点通过 P2P 方法组成的去中心化网络来说,“免信任性” 和验证效率无疑是关键。也就是说,这些系统需要找到方法把信息编码成紧凑的形式,同时让参与者能够安全快速地进行验证。比特币...

知识:工作量证明,比特币和以太坊,比特币,以太坊

7. 什么是哈希函数?

...相同的数据块极为困难。抗篡改能力:对于一个数据块,哪怕只改动其一个比特位,其 hash 值的改动也会非常大。在用到 hash 进行管理的数据结构中,比如 hashmap,hash 值(key)存在的目的是加速键值对的查找,key 的作用是为了将元素适当地放在各个桶里,对于抗碰撞的要求没有那么高。换句话说,hash ...

知识:比特币,哈希

8. 密码学家王小云:中国亟需抢先制订区块链等领域密码协议标准规范

...类信息系统,数字证书、网上银行、电子支付、网络安全协议、数字货币、比特币、区块链、可证明安全密码等,「blockchain」其实是从哈希函数中提取的一个专业概念。王小云现任清华大学高等研究院杨振宁讲座教授,2017 年当选中国科学院院士,2019 年当选国际密码协会会士 (IACR Fellow),同年获得未来...

知识:比特币,区块链,物联网,技术,密码学,观点,王小云

9. 技术解码|区块链中的散列函数及Filecoin的选择

...种情况也很普遍),通常可以看见的是用来进行单向计算和验证。比如说在比特币中采用 SHA256 来进行选举运算获得出块权,以及采用SHA256 和 RIPEMD-160 来从私钥计算公钥和地址。除了hash函数的一般性特性只要,用于密码学的 hash 函数有更严格的要求:单向性:从数据求散列值很容易,但不能倒推。或者...

知识:区块链,区块,函数,算法

10. 技术解码,区块链中的散列函数及Filecoin的选择

...种情况也很普遍),通常可以看见的是用来进行单向计算和验证。比如说在比特币中采用 SHA256 来进行选举运算获得出块权,以及采用SHA256 和 RIPEMD-160 来从私钥计算公钥和地址。除了hash函数的一般性特性只要,用于密码学的 hash 函数有更严格的要求:单向性:从数据求散列值很容易,但不能倒推。或者...

知识:区块链,散列函数,IPFS,FILECOIN,火星号精选

11. 区块链基础知识 你知道多少?

...5.算法RSA、Elgamal、D-H、ECCSHA256、 RIMPED1606.通常使用椭圆曲线算法生成密钥对比特币密钥长度:256位公钥哈希值=RIMPED160(SHA256(公钥))比特币地址=?1?+Base58(0+公钥哈希值+校验码)校验码=前四字节(SHA256(SHA256(0+公钥哈希值)))7.加密发送方使用接收方的公钥加密数据接收方使用本方的私钥解密数据通常使用本方面...

知识:区块,节点,密钥,算法

12. 一文告诉你密码学在区块链中能做什么?

...用,从而理解为什么区块链可以防止消息被篡改、怎么进行数字身份认证。比特币中是如何通过多重签名实现多个人共同管理某个账户的比特币交易。 布隆过滤器布隆过滤器是一种基于 Hash 的高效查找结构,能够快速判断某个元素是否在一个集合内。首先回顾一下基于Hash的快速查找,由于Hash算法具有...

知识:同态,区块,密码学,证书

13. 用户密码加密存储十问十答,一文说透密码安全存储

...内衣里钱,虽然你用到他们的概率不大,但关键时刻他们能救命。那用加密算法比如AES,把密码加密下再存,需要明文的时候我再解密。不行。这涉及到怎么保存用来加密解密的密钥,虽然密钥一般跟用户信息分开存储,且业界也有一些成熟的、基于软件或硬件的密钥存储方案。但跟用户信息的保存一...

知识:算法,黑客,存储,密码学,加密

14. 在透明的公链网络中如何实现数据的隐私保护

提到比特元公链技术,相信大家印象最深刻的就是,比特元公链底层技术有500+项区块链专利保障。但大部分社区伙伴并不能直接理解这众多专利的价值以及各个专利在比特元公链技术中具体起到了什么样的作用。基于以上原因,也为进一步深度剖析比特元公链,比特元公众号特别更新一个专利科普专题...

知识:链上,比特元,公链,区块链加密

15. 区块链入门篇-人人都懂区块链

...链,数字货币和法币的关系,全球主要的数字货币,如何去使用数字货币,比特币,以太坊等数字货币未来能做什么。区块链系统开发找王小姐189-微2421-电4445,区块链系统开发模式,区块链平台开发本公司是系统软件开发商,非平台,非平台,非平台。数字货币介绍本文主要介绍什么是数字货币,什么...

知识:区块链平台开发,区块链系统开发